Jiménez Dorado

About
Jiménez Dorado is a Spanish bus company with over 35 years of experience in passenger transport, established in 1990 by D. Rafael Jiménez Pérez. They specialize in coach hire services for transfers, conventions, and corporate events across Spain and Europe, including vehicles adapted for people with mobility problems. The company is known for its commitment to safety and environmental conservation, being a pioneer in Spain for implementing road safety measures and holding various quality certifications. Jiménez Dorado offers a range of services, including regular and discretionary road transport, with a fleet of over 100 buses. Popular routes include connections between Valencia, Madrid, and Ávila.

FlixBus

About
FlixBus is one of Europe’s leading low-cost bus companies, founded in Germany and now offering long-distance services across Europe and the United States. In addition to its extensive daytime network, FlixBus also operates overnight buses on select European routes. Standard amenities include free Wi-Fi, power outlets to charge devices, extra legroom, luggage space, and onboard toilets, with snacks and drinks available for purchase. FlixBus offers a single Standard ticket type for all routes, which includes one carry-on bag and one checked bag per passenger. Additional fees apply for extra luggage and for reserving specific seats, such as Extra Seats, Table Seats, or Panorama Seats. This combination of affordability, comfort, and wide coverage makes FlixBus a popular choice for budget-conscious travelers.

BlaBlaCar

About
BlaBlaCar is a French online marketplace for carpooling, connecting drivers with empty seats and passengers traveling to the same destination to share costs. Founded in 2006, it operates in Europe and Latin America, boasting 26 million active members. The platform also includes BlaBlaCar Bus, an intercity bus service. BlaBlaCar's name comes from its rating system for drivers' chattiness: \Bla\" for quiet, \"BlaBla\" for talkative, and \"BlaBlaBla\" for very chatty. The company aims to be the leading marketplace for shared travel, offering affordable and sustainable solutions by combining carpooling with bus journeys."
